summaryrefslogtreecommitdiff
path: root/TAO/tao/ZIOP/ZIOP_Policy_i.cpp
diff options
context:
space:
mode:
Diffstat (limited to 'TAO/tao/ZIOP/ZIOP_Policy_i.cpp')
-rw-r--r--TAO/tao/ZIOP/ZIOP_Policy_i.cpp8
1 files changed, 1 insertions, 7 deletions
diff --git a/TAO/tao/ZIOP/ZIOP_Policy_i.cpp b/TAO/tao/ZIOP/ZIOP_Policy_i.cpp
index c6306341d7a..8a25e5b902c 100644
--- a/TAO/tao/ZIOP/ZIOP_Policy_i.cpp
+++ b/TAO/tao/ZIOP/ZIOP_Policy_i.cpp
@@ -81,13 +81,7 @@ CompressorIdLevelListPolicy::destroy (void)
::Compression::CompressorIdLevelList *
CompressorIdLevelListPolicy::compressor_ids (void)
{
- ::Compression::CompressorIdLevelList *tmp = 0;
- ACE_NEW_THROW_EX (tmp,
- ::Compression::CompressorIdLevelList (this->value_),
- CORBA::NO_MEMORY (TAO::VMCID,
- CORBA::COMPLETED_NO));
-
- return tmp;
+ return &this->value_;
}
TAO_Cached_Policy_Type